I think it's the "amount" of unpainted cladding, not just unpainted cladding, per say. The vehicles I mentioned use it, but only where it makes sense, such as around the wheel wells, or down close to the lower body edge, or on the lower edges of the bumpers. Those are areas in which unpainted cladding makes more sense than painted surfaces.
 
I think on these vehicles, it really is "form following function," rather than a "market positioning statement."
 
Also, I'm not so sure it's just lots of unpainted cladding, but lots of matte black paint too that conveys a "base-level" image. Look at all the Ford trucks with black grilles and black bumpers. Those are the entry-level XL trim lines.
 
So I will agree that lots of unpainted cladding or matte black paint, suggest entry-level models, but a little unpainted cladding doesn't convey that feeling at all. It all comes down to how it's used.
